Rickie is back .... 人生·工作的结果=思维方式×热情×能力

今天比昨天更好,明天比今天更好,为此,不屈不挠地工作、勤勤恳恳地经营、孜孜不倦地修炼,我们人生的目的和价值就是这样确确实实地存在着。

  博客园 :: 首页 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::
  397 随笔 :: 3 文章 :: 1310 评论 :: 129 引用

2011年7月9日 #

关于大型网站的架构设计,包括hardware和software等等,经常有朋友谈及这个问题。

这里推荐两篇非常好的文章,如何随着业务/访问量的增长,升级或扩展现有的系统架构设计。

大型网站的服务器架构设计-1

大型网站的服务器架构设计-2

=== 节选内容 ===

网站初始

架设入门网站其实很容易,在基本的架构是安装一台Web Server 及一台 Database Server,这样的架构在流量不高的个人网站而言,的确已足够了。但其实风险很高,因为没有考虑日后的扩充性(Scalability),也没有考虑到系统容错及恢复能力(High Availability & Failover),因此只要流量一高,问题就接踵而至。

商业化架构

在筹到一笔资金后,网站就可以进行商业化架构设计,一般商业化的标准架构,如下图所示:

posted @ 2011-07-09 10:35 Rickie 阅读(694) 评论(0) 编辑